Identify your sofa fabric first

Wrong cleaning method on the wrong fabric causes permanent damage. Before you book anyone, spend two minutes identifying what your sofa is made of. The stakes are real: foam-based shampooing on velvet flattens the pile. Wet extraction on poor-quality leather causes cracking and peeling that no amount of conditioning fixes. Here’s a quick field guide.

Fabric identification: a visual and tactile test

  • Microfiber: Feels like suede, rebounds when you rub it against the grain. Very common in Bangalore apartments and handles foam shampooing well.
  • Cotton blend: Slightly rough texture with visible weave pattern. Absorbs water quickly, so low-moisture methods prevent shrinkage.
  • Velvet: Distinct pile direction, reflects light differently from each angle. Dry extraction only. Never wet-clean velvet without specialist equipment.
  • Leather (genuine): Cool to touch, uniform surface, develops patina over time. Needs leather-safe conditioner post-clean; skip anything alkaline.
  • Faux leather / PU: Warmer than genuine leather, may peel at edges. Gentle wipe-down only. Avoid moisture-heavy methods entirely.

Check the sofa’s underside or inside the armrest for a care label. The codes W (water-based cleaning), S (solvent only), WS (either), and X (vacuum only) tell you what’s safe immediately. Providers who don’t ask about your fabric before quoting? Red flag.

Match your stain to the right cleaning method

Most providers default to foam shampooing. It works for general dust and light staining. It doesn’t work for everything.

Stain / Situation Right Method Why
Pet urine UV detection + enzymatic treatment Foam shampoo masks odour; enzymes break the urea compound at source
Wine or curry Immediate blotting + pH-neutral foam Alkaline foam on tannin stains sets them permanently
Mold or mildew Dry extraction first, then sanitisation spray Wet methods spread mold spores; dry extraction removes them before treatment
General dust / odour Foam shampooing + wet extraction Standard process; effective for maintenance cleaning
Ink or dye Solvent-based spot treatment (specialist only) Water-based methods spread ink; excluded from most base prices

UV and HEPA cleaning (marketed by some Bangalore providers as premium) uses ultraviolet light to spot biological stains invisible to the eye, then HEPA-filtered vacuuming captures fine particles. Genuinely useful for homes with allergies or pets. For a sofa that just needs maintenance? You don’t need it.

What sofa cleaning actually costs in Bangalore

Advertised rates start at ₹145 per seat and climb to ₹849 for a full fabric sofa service. That gap isn’t random. It’s driven by add-ons most listings bury or skip entirely.

₹399-₹849, typical base rate for a 3-seater fabric sofa in Bangalore (Urban Company, HomeTriangle, CleanFanatics data, 2025-2026)

  • Recliners excluded from most packages, charged separately at ₹249+
  • Cushion cleaning is often an add-on
  • Ink, dye, permanent stains explicitly excluded by every major provider
  • Same-day or rush service adds 20-30%
  • Leather conditioning (post-clean) is extra on leather sofas, not bundled

“100% stain removal” is false advertising.

No legitimate process removes set ink, old dye, or structural discolouration. Any provider promising this without inspection isn’t being straight with you.

DIY vs. professional: the real decision

DIY works for surface dust and fresh spills on microfiber or cotton blend. A handheld vacuum plus mild soap-water solution handles most weekly upkeep. Where DIY fails (and fails badly):

  • Mold or mildew spreads the problem instead of solving it
  • Pet urine odour compounds require enzymatic treatment, not scrubbing
  • New sofas under warranty improper cleaning voids the manufacturer guarantee
  • Velvet, silk, heirloom fabric one wrong move is irreversible
  • Household members with dust allergies or asthma deep HEPA extraction removes allergens DIY redistributes

Bangalore’s humidity and monsoon impact

Bangalore’s monsoon (June through September) pushes humidity above 80% during peak months. This creates a specific post-cleaning problem: sofas cleaned with wet extraction during monsoon can take 6-10 hours to dry fully instead of the standard 2-3 hours. Damp upholstery left sitting longer than that starts developing mildew within 24 hours.

Post-cleaning protocol for Bangalore homes

  1. Schedule cleaning on a dry, low-humidity day. October through February is ideal.
  2. Run a ceiling fan on high over the sofa for at least 4 hours post-clean
  3. Keep windows open for cross-ventilation. Avoid AC immediately after, since cold air slows evaporation.
  4. Ask about fabric protector spray (silicone-based coating that repels liquid and reduces re-soiling). Worth the extra ₹200-₹300 on fabric sofas.
  5. Re-clean every 6 months if you have pets, every 12 months otherwise

And here’s something most homeowners don’t know: Bangalore’s water hardness leaves mineral residue in cleaning solutions. Providers using soft-water-treated solutions or distilled water for the final rinse deliver better results on light-coloured upholstery. Ask specifically about this.

How to vet a provider before booking

Five questions to ask any sofa cleaning service in Bangalore before confirming:

  • What chemicals do you use and are they certified non-toxic for children and pets?
  • Are recliners, cushions, and stain removal included in the quoted price or separate?
  • What happens if cleaning damages the fabric? Do you carry liability insurance?
  • Do you offer a before/after photo guarantee?
  • What’s your drying time estimate and do you account for current humidity?

Providers with 4.8+ ratings and 1,000+ reviews on Urban Company or HomeTriangle have accountability built in. Independent providers often quote lower but carry more risk with no recourse if something goes wrong. Is it worth getting a sofa professionally cleaned?

Yes, for situations where DIY won’t work: pet stains, mold, allergies, velvet or leather fabric, or a sofa still under warranty. Professional cleaning also extends sofa lifespan by removing abrasive dirt particles that degrade upholstery fibres over time. For standard dust and light soiling, a good vacuum and occasional spot clean is sufficient.
